| Package | Description |
|---|---|
| com.denodo.common.custom.policy |
Provides the enums and classes needed to represent the evaluation of
Custom Policies for Virtual DataPort and to access to its context.
|
| Modifier and Type | Field and Description |
|---|---|
static CustomMaskingExpression |
CustomMaskingExpression.DEFAULT
Returns a DEFAULT
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.FIRST_4
Returns a FIRST_4
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.HIDE
Returns a HIDE
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.LATEST_4
Returns a LATEST_4
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.ONLY_YEAR
Returns a ONLY_YEAR
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.REDACT
Returns a REDACT
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.REDACT_ASTERISK
Returns a REDACT_ASTERISK
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.REMOVE_DAY
Returns a REMOVE_DAY
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.REMOVE_TIME
Returns a REMOVE_TIME
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.ROUND
Returns a ROUND
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.SET_0
Returns a SET_0
CustomMaskingExpression.Type instance. |
static CustomMaskingExpression |
CustomMaskingExpression.SET_MINUS_1
Returns a SET_MINUS_1
CustomMaskingExpression.Type instance. |
| Modifier and Type | Method and Description |
|---|---|
static CustomMaskingExpression |
CustomMaskingExpression.customMasking(String customExpression)
Creates a new CUSTOM expression.
|
CustomMaskingExpression |
CustomRestrictionPolicyValue.getDefaultMaskingExpression()
Returns the default masking expression used for those fields using Default
CustomMaskingExpression.Type |
| Modifier and Type | Method and Description |
|---|---|
Map<String,CustomMaskingExpression> |
CustomRestrictionPolicyValue.getSensitiveFieldsExpressions()
Returns the map of field names that will be used to decide how the
restriction will be applied when the custom policy evaluates to
CustomRestrictionPolicyType.ACCEPT_WITH_FILTER. |
| Constructor and Description |
|---|
CustomRestrictionPolicyValue(CustomRestrictionPolicyType policyType,
CustomRestrictionPolicyFilterType filterType,
String condition,
CustomMaskingExpression defaultMaskingExpression,
Map<String,CustomMaskingExpression> sensitiveFields) |
| Constructor and Description |
|---|
CustomRestrictionPolicyValue(CustomRestrictionPolicyType policyType,
CustomRestrictionPolicyFilterType filterType,
String condition,
CustomMaskingExpression defaultMaskingExpression,
Map<String,CustomMaskingExpression> sensitiveFields) |
Copyright © 2024 Denodo Technologies. All rights reserved.